The SunOS 5.5 mailtool seems to follow symlinks when enabling the vacation feature, so if you ln -s /var/mail/luser ~/.forward and then enable vacation it copies /var/mail/luser to ~/.forward and appends "|/usr/bin/vacation me" to it (and moves the symlink to ~/.forward..BACKUP - I'm not sure if you can do any damage using that and I no longer have a 5.5 machine handy to check it).
